Ethical Reasoning in the Mental Health Professions by Gary G Ford
Explores how to develop the ability to reason ethically in difficult situations. This book provides you with the needed background in methods of ethical reasoning and introduces a nine-step model of ethical decision-making for resolving ethical dilemmas. It discusses the ethical codes of both psychology and counseling.
